Patents Covered by one or more of the following patents: US Patent No. 6,502,643 US Patent No. 6,868,917 AU Patent No. 722593 GB Patent No. 2336777 Product Description The Reliable Model JL-17 Early Suppression Fast Response (ESFR) Sprinkler with a nominal k-factor of 16.8 (240 metric). This sprinkler is designed to respond quickly to growing fires and will deliver a heavy water discharge to "suppress" rather than "control" fires. FM Global classifies the Model JL-17 as a quick-response sprinkler, storage and non-storage, when the sprinkler is used in accordance with FM Global Property Loss Pre- vention Data Sheets. The Model JL-17 ESFR sprinkler utilizes a levered fus- ible alloy solder link in either a 165°F (74°C) or a 212°F (100°C) rating. Model JL-17 sprinklers are cULus Listed for compliance with UL/ULC 1767, including the high clearance test for rack storage. The Model JL-17 ESFR sprinkler was designed to be shorter and more compact than other ESFR sprinklers. The shorter sprinkler allows piping to be installed farther from the ceiling and obstructions. The JL-1 7 ESFR sprin- kler is also less susceptible to damage due to smaller deflector and frame design. The lighter JL-17 ESFR passed rough use and abuse listing tests without plastic protectors. Model JL-17 ESFR Sprinkler Application and Installation The Model JL-17 ESFR sprinkler is intended for instal- lation in accordance with NFPA 13 and FM Loss Pre- vention Data Sheets 2-0 and 8-9, as well as the require- ments of any Authorities Having Jurisdiction. See Table 1 for information on NFPA and FM Global design criteria for the Model JL-17 sprinkler. Use only the Model Ji sprinkler wrench for removal and installation. Any other type of wrench may damage the sprinkler. A grooved wrench boss is provided on the sprinkler to limit the potential for the wrench to slip during installation. When handling sprin- klers, hold sprinklers only on frame arms and 557 do not apply any force on the link assembly. Sprin- Model Ji klers should be tight- Sprinkler Wrench ened between 14 - 40 ft- lbs (19 - 54 N-m) torque. Sprinklers not tightened to recommended torque may cause leakage or impairment of the sprinkler. Damage sprinklers must be replaced immediately. NFPA and, where applicable, FM Global standards shall be consulted for complete de- sign and installation criteria. Sprinkler Position: Pendent, align frame arms with the pipe. Deflectors should be parallel with the ceil- ing or roof. System Type: Wet Pipe Systems Only. Maximum area of coverage: 100 ft2 (9.3m2), greater coverage areas are allowable in some cases. Minimum area of coverage: 64 ft2 (5.8m2). Maximum slope ceiling: 2/12 pitch (9.5°). Maximum spacing: 12 ft (3.7m) for building heights up to 30 ft (9.1m) and 10 feet (3.1m) for building heights greater than 30 ft (9.1m). Minimum spacing: 8 feet (2.4m). Deflector distance from walls: At least 4 inches (102mm) from walls, and no more than one-half the allowable distance permitted between sprinklers. Deflector to Top of Storage: at least 36 in (900mm). Deflector to ceiling Distance: 6 - 14 in (150 - 350mm) per NFPA 13. Center Line of Thermal Sensing Element To Ceiling Distance: 2- 13 in (50 - 330mm) for smooth ceilings or 4- 13 in (100- 330mm)for non- smooth ceilings per FM Data Sheet 2-0. Maintenance The Model JL-17 ESFR Sprinkler should be inspected and the sprinkler system maintained in accordance with NFPA 25. Do not clean sprinkler with soap and water, ammonia or any other cleaning fluid. Replace any sprin- kler that has been painted (other than factory applied) or damaged in any way. A stock of spare sprinklers should be maintained to allow quick replacement of damaged or operated sprinklers. Prior to installation, sprinklers should be maintained in the original cartons and packaging until used, to minimize the potential for damage to sprinklers that would cause improper operation or non-operation. Once operated, automatic sprinklers cannot be reassem- bled and reused. New sprinklers of the same size, type and temperature rating must be installed. A cabinet of re- placement sprinklers should be provided for this purpose.
